วิธีแปล WordPress Form Plugins ให้เป็นภาษาท้องถิ่น: Gravity Forms & Contact Form 7

คุณใช้เวลาหลายสัปดาห์ในการแปลเว็บไซต์ WordPress ทั้งหมดของคุณให้เป็นภาษาท้องถิ่น หน้าแรกดูสวยงามในภาษาฝรั่งเศส ร้านค้า WooCommerce ของคุณได้รับการแปลเป็นภาษาสเปนอย่างสมบูรณ์แบบ และ Traffic ทั่วโลกของคุณก็เพิ่มขึ้นอย่างรวดเร็ว
แต่ Lead Generation ของคุณกลับซบเซา ทำไมล่ะ
คุณทดสอบหน้า "ติดต่อเรา" และปล่อยให้ช่องที่จำเป็นว่างเปล่า ทันใดนั้น ข้อความแจ้งข้อผิดพลาดสีแดงสดก็ปรากฏขึ้น: "This field is required." เป็นภาษาอังกฤษ
แบบฟอร์มเป็นเหมือนคอขวดของการ Conversion หากผู้ใช้ไม่สามารถเข้าใจ Placeholder, ข้อความแสดงความสำเร็จ หรือข้อผิดพลาดในการตรวจสอบ พวกเขาจะออกจากหน้าเว็บ อย่างไรก็ตาม การแปล Form Builder ที่ซับซ้อน เช่น Gravity Forms, Contact Form 7 (CF7) หรือ WPForms อาจก่อให้เกิดอันตรายทางเทคนิคที่ไม่เหมือนใคร ซึ่งอาจทำให้กระบวนการ Lead Capture ของคุณเสียหายโดยสิ้นเชิง
ปัญหาทางเทคนิค: ทำไมการแปลแบบฟอร์มถึงเสียหาย
Form Plugins เป็นเหมือนเครื่องมือประมวลผลข้อมูล พวกเขาไม่ได้แสดงข้อความคงที่เท่านั้น แต่ยังใช้ตัวแปร Dynamic, Merge Tag และ Shortcode เพื่อส่งอีเมลและตรวจสอบ Input ของผู้ใช้
นี่คือเหตุผลที่การแปลเป็นเหมือนทุ่งระเบิด:
1. อันตรายจาก Merge Tag และ Shortcode
Form Plugins พึ่งพาส่วนประกอบ (Syntax) ที่เป็นกรรมสิทธิ์ของตัวเองเป็นอย่างมากในการทำงาน
- Gravity Forms ใช้ Merge Tag:
{all_fields},{admin_email},{Name:2} - Contact Form 7 ใช้ Shortcode:
[text* your-name],[email* your-email]
หากคุณป้อน String เหล่านี้ลงในเครื่องมือแปล AI ทั่วไป (เช่น ChatGPT หรือ Google Translate) AI จะพยายาม "แปล" หรือจัดรูปแบบ Code ใหม่ Tag อย่าง {admin_email} อาจกลายเป็น {correo_de_admin}
ผลลัพธ์คืออะไร แบบฟอร์มถูกส่ง แต่ทีมขายของคุณไม่ได้รับการแจ้งเตือนทางอีเมล เพราะ Tag สำหรับ Routing ถูกทำลายไปแล้ว
2. AJAX และ Database Bloat
Form สมัยใหม่ส่วนใหญ่ส่งผ่าน AJAX เพื่อไม่ให้ต้องโหลดหน้าเว็บใหม่ หากคุณใช้ Multilingual Plugin ที่หนักและใช้ Database เป็นจำนวนมาก เพื่อจัดการการแปลของคุณ ทุกครั้งที่ส่งแบบฟอร์ม จะกระตุ้นให้เกิดการ Query Database หลายครั้ง เพียงแค่ค้นหาคำแปลที่ถูกต้องสำหรับ "ขอบคุณสำหรับข้อความของคุณ" ซึ่งจะทำให้การตอบสนองของ AJAX ช้าลง ทำให้ผู้ใช้คลิกปุ่ม "Submit" หลายครั้งด้วยความหงุดหงิด
3. Hidden Validation Strings
Core ไฟล์ .pot สำหรับ Plugins เช่น Gravity Forms มี String นับพัน String ซึ่งหลาย String เป็นข้อผิดพลาดในการตรวจสอบที่ไม่ชัดเจน (The uploaded file exceeds the maximum allowed size) ไฟล์ขนาดใหญ่มหึมาเหล่านี้มีแนวโน้มที่จะทำให้ Online Editor พื้นฐานล่ม หรือทำให้ Server ของคุณหมดเวลา หากคุณพยายามประมวลผลบน Site
Cloud-Based Solution สำหรับ Form Localization
เพื่อให้แปล Form ของคุณเป็นภาษาท้องถิ่นได้อย่างปลอดภัย คุณต้องใช้ไฟล์ .mo ของ WordPress เพื่อให้การส่ง AJAX รวดเร็วเหมือนสายฟ้า และคุณต้องปกป้อง Syntax ที่เป็นเอกลักษณ์ของ Form ของคุณ
นี่คือจุดที่ SimplePoTranslate มอบความได้เปรียบที่ไม่ยุติธรรม
เราประมวลผลไฟล์แปลของคุณใน Cloud สร้างไฟล์ .mo ที่มีขนาดเล็ก ซึ่งไม่ต้อง Lookup Database เลย ทำให้มั่นใจได้ว่า Form ของคุณจะถูกส่งทันที
วิธีที่เราปกป้อง Lead Generation ของคุณ
- Code Safety & Syntax Locking (Core USP): สิ่งนี้สำคัญอย่างยิ่งสำหรับ Form ก่อนทำการแปล Engine ของเราจะ Parse ไฟล์
.poของคุณ และ Lock ทุกตัวแปร, HTML Tag (<strong>,<br/>), CF7 Shortcode และ Gravity Forms Merge Tag ทางคณิตศาสตร์ AI จะแปลข้อความที่อยู่รอบๆ แต่ Tag{all_fields}ของคุณจะยังคงอยู่เหมือนเดิม คุณจะได้รับการแปลที่สมบูรณ์แบบ โดยที่ ไม่มี Form ใดเสียหาย - Context-Aware AI: คำศัพท์ของ Form มีความเฉพาะเจาะจง LLM ขั้นสูงของเรา (Class Gemini/GPT-4) เข้าใจว่า "Submit" หมายถึงการกระทำของปุ่ม ไม่ใช่ "การยอมจำนนต่ออำนาจ" คุณจะได้รับการแปลทางธุรกิจที่ถูกต้องตามบริบท
- Smart Batching: Gravity Forms และ Add-on จำนวนมาก มีไฟล์ภาษาขนาดใหญ่ เทคโนโลยี Smart Batching ของเราจะแยกไฟล์ขนาดใหญ่นี้ออกเป็น Chunk ที่จัดการได้ ประมวลผล และรวมเข้าด้วยกัน คุณสามารถแปลไฟล์ขนาดใหญ่ได้ โดยไม่ทำให้ Server Timeout
- Pluralization Support: เราสนับสนุน Gettext Pluralization ที่ซับซ้อน (
msgid_plural) หาก Form ของคุณมีขีดจำกัดในการอัปโหลดไฟล์ ผู้ใช้ของคุณจะเห็นคำเตือนที่ถูกต้องตามหลักไวยากรณ์ ไม่ว่าพวกเขาจะพยายามอัปโหลด "1 file" หรือ "5 files" ในภาษาต่างๆ เช่น ภาษาโปแลนด์หรือภาษารัสเซีย
รักษาความปลอดภัยให้กับ Conversions ของคุณวันนี้
หยุดการสูญเสีย Leads ระหว่างประเทศให้กับข้อความแจ้งข้อผิดพลาดภาษาอังกฤษที่สับสน และ Tag อีเมลที่เสียหาย
แปล Form Plugins ของคุณอย่างปลอดภัย สร้าง Static File ของคุณใน Cloud ของเรา อัปโหลดไปยัง Folder /wp-content/languages/plugins/ ของคุณ และดู Conversion Rate ของคุณเป็นปกติทั่วโลก
เรามี Free Tier ที่ใจกว้าง เพื่อให้คุณสามารถทดสอบ Syntax Locking ของเรากับ Form String ที่ซับซ้อนที่สุดของคุณได้ (หมายเหตุ: เนื่องจากเรามีค่าใช้จ่าย AI API ทันที เราจึงไม่คืนเงินสำหรับ Paid Tier ดังนั้นเราขอแนะนำให้คุณใช้ Free Tier ให้เต็มที่ เพื่อให้แน่ใจว่าเหมาะสมกับ Workflow ของคุณอย่างสมบูรณ์แบบ!)
พร้อมที่จะแปลโดยไม่ต้องปวดหัวแล้วหรือยัง เริ่มต้นฟรีที่ SimplePoTranslate.com